ARQC_ComputadorasParalelo

Páginas: 38 (9401 palabras) Publicado: 23 de noviembre de 2014

ARQUITECTURA DE COMPUTADORAS













CAPITULO VII



COMPUTADORAS PARALELO






AÑO 2014





IX - INTRODUCCIÓN:

La tendencia actual para alcanzar grandes velocidades y capacidades de elaboración de datos, que son necesarias para el llamado procesamiento de inteligencia, es la disponer varios procesadores en paralelo, actuando simultáneamente.Las ventajas de estos sistemas son notables, por cuanto hacen uso de procesadores estándar para alcanzar enormes velocidades de cálculo, del orden de un TIPS (Tera Instrucciones Por Segundo) o sea 1012 instrucciones por segundo, y ya se avizora el funcionamiento en el orden de los PIPS o sea Peta Instrucciones por Segundo que corresponde a 1018 IPS.

La evolución de las computadoras, desde elpunto de vista de los sistemas operativos, nos muestra la siguiente secuencia de innovaciones:

1 - Procesamiento por lotes: En el cual cada programa es cargado y ejecutado, en forma separada.

2 - Multiprogramación: En el cual se carga una serie de programas en memoria, y se ejecutan de acuerdo a las necesidades de cada uno.

3 - Tiempo compartido: En este caso, todos los programas estáncargados en la memoria, y se asigna un tiempo de ejecución para cada uno, en forma tal que parecen ejecutarse todos simultáneamente.

4 - Multiprocesamiento: En este caso se disponen varias unidades de procesamiento, en forma tal que operan simultáneamente sobre varios programas.

También, desde el punto de vista de la arquitectura, se han tenido niveles de sofisticación crecientes, quepodemos sintetizar en:

1 - Procesamiento de datos: es el tipo de procesamiento que mayormente se emplea aún actualmente, pues consiste en operar sobre datos alfanuméricos no relacionados

2 - Procesamiento de información: La información consiste en un cúmulo de datos, que están de alguna manera ligados mediante una estructura sintáctica o una relación espacial cualquiera.

3 - Procesamiento deconocimientos: El conocimiento, es una forma de información más algún significado semántico, o sea que forman un sub-espacio de la información.

4 - Procesamiento de inteligencia: La inteligencia, es derivada de una colección de ítems de conocimiento.


Figura IX - 1 : Espacio de procesamiento.

Estos elementos son representables, mediante un diagrama de Venn en forma piramidal, tal como elindicado en la figura VII.1.

El "Procesamiento paralelo" es una forma de cálculo que favorece la presencia de eventos concurrentes, siendo concurrentes los eventos que presentan:

- Paralelismo
- Simultaneidad
- Solapamiento

Los procesos paralelos son los que se producen en distintos recursos al mismo tiempo, los procesaos simultáneos son los que pueden producirse,en distintos recursos al mismo tiempo, y los procesos solapados son los que pueden producirse en intervalos de tiempo superpuestos.

El nivel más elevado del procesamiento paralelo es el de llevar a cabo múltiples tareas mediante sistemas de multiprogramación, tiempo compartido y multiprocesamiento, por lo que, resumiendo, el procesamiento paralelo es un desafío que puede ser abordado desdecuatro niveles:

- de programación (Algoritmos)
- de procedimientos (Interacción hard-soft)
- de interisntrucciones (Interacción soft-hard)
- de intrainstrucciones (Hardware)

O sea que la tarea primordial, es la de implementar algoritmos que permitan realizar tareas en paralelo, continuando con los procedimientos y los sistemas operativos para tal objetivo, y terminando conla construcción de sistemas con organizaciones que permitan la realización de tareas simultáneas.

Lo dicho sugiere que el procesamiento paralelo es un campo de estudios combinado, en el cual debe hacerse un perfecto balance entre hardware y software.

Otro tipo de procesamiento muy relacionado con el procesamiento paralelo, es el procesamiento distribuido, en el cual se utilizan diversas...
Leer documento completo

Regístrate para leer el documento completo.

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S